  1 /*
  2  *      PCI Class and Device Name Tables
  3  *
  4  *      Copyright 1993--1999 Drew Eckhardt, Frederic Potter,
  5  *      David Mosberger-Tang, Martin Mares
  6  */
  7 
  8 #include <linux/config.h>
  9 #include <linux/types.h>
 10 #include <linux/kernel.h>
 11 #include <linux/pci.h>
 12 #include <linux/init.h>
 13 
 14 #ifdef CONFIG_PCI_NAMES
 15 
 16 struct pci_device_info {
 17         unsigned short device;
 18         unsigned short seen;
 19         const char *name;
 20 };
 21 
 22 struct pci_vendor_info {
 23         unsigned short vendor;
 24         unsigned short nr;
 25         const char *name;
 26         struct pci_device_info *devices;
 27 };
 28 
 29 /*
 30  * This is ridiculous, but we want the strings in
 31  * the .init section so that they don't take up
 32  * real memory.. Parse the same file multiple times
 33  * to get all the info.
 34  */
 35 #define VENDOR( vendor, name )          static const char __vendorstr_##vendor[] __initdata = name;
 36 #define ENDVENDOR()
 37 #define DEVICE( vendor, device, name )  static const char __devicestr_##vendor##device[] __initdata = name;
 38 #include "devlist.h"
 39 
 40 
 41 #define VENDOR( vendor, name )          static struct pci_device_info __devices_##vendor[] __initdata = {
 42 #define ENDVENDOR()                     };
 43 #define DEVICE( vendor, device, name )  { 0x##device, 0, __devicestr_##vendor##device },
 44 #include "devlist.h"
 45 
 46 static const struct pci_vendor_info __initdata pci_vendor_list[] = {
 47 #define VENDOR( vendor, name )          { 0x##vendor, sizeof(__devices_##vendor) / sizeof(struct pci_device_info), __vendorstr_##vendor, __devices_##vendor },
 48 #define ENDVENDOR()
 49 #define DEVICE( vendor, device, name )
 50 #include "devlist.h"
 51 };
 52 
 53 #define VENDORS (sizeof(pci_vendor_list)/sizeof(struct pci_vendor_info))
 54 
 55 void __init pci_name_device(struct pci_dev *dev)
 56 {
 57         const struct pci_vendor_info *vendor_p = pci_vendor_list;
 58         int i = VENDORS;
 59         char *name = dev->name;
 60 
 61         do {
 62                 if (vendor_p->vendor == dev->vendor)
 63                         goto match_vendor;
 64                 vendor_p++;
 65         } while (--i);
 66 
 67         /* Couldn't find either the vendor nor the device */
 68         sprintf(name, "PCI device %04x:%04x", dev->vendor, dev->device);
 69         return;
 70 
 71         match_vendor: {
 72                 struct pci_device_info *device_p = vendor_p->devices;
 73                 int i = vendor_p->nr;
 74 
 75                 while (i > 0) {
 76                         if (device_p->device == dev->device)
 77                                 goto match_device;
 78                         device_p++;
 79                         i--;
 80                 }
 81 
 82                 /* Ok, found the vendor, but unknown device */
 83                 sprintf(name, "PCI device %04x:%04x (%s)", dev->vendor, dev->device, vendor_p->name);
 84                 return;
 85 
 86                 /* Full match */
 87                 match_device: {
 88                         char *n = name + sprintf(name, "%s %s", vendor_p->name, device_p->name);
 89                         int nr = device_p->seen + 1;
 90                         device_p->seen = nr;
 91                         if (nr > 1)
 92                                 sprintf(n, " (#%d)", nr);
 93                 }
 94         }
 95 }
 96 
 97 /*
 98  *  Class names. Not in .init section as they are needed in runtime.
 99  */
100 
101 static u16 pci_class_numbers[] = {
102 #define CLASS(x,y) 0x##x,
103 #include "classlist.h"
104 };
105 
106 static char *pci_class_names[] = {
107 #define CLASS(x,y) y,
108 #include "classlist.h"
109 };
110 
111 char *
112 pci_class_name(u32 class)
113 {
114         int i;
115 
116         for(i=0; i<sizeof(pci_class_numbers)/sizeof(pci_class_numbers[0]); i++)
117                 if (pci_class_numbers[i] == class)
118                         return pci_class_names[i];
119         return NULL;
120 }
121 
122 #else
123 
124 void __init pci_name_device(struct pci_dev *dev)
125 {
126 }
127 
128 char *
129 pci_class_name(u32 class)
130 {
131         return NULL;
132 }
133 
134 #endif /* CONFIG_PCI_NAMES */
135 
136
